Global Scientific Instruments Market size was valued at USD 41.13 billion in 2022 and is poised to grow from USD 42.94 billion in 2023 to USD 60.60 billion by 2031, growing at a CAGR of 4.4% in the forecast period (2024- 2031).
The Global Scientific Instruments Market is a broad and lively industry that includes a wide range of tools used in research, analysis, and experiments across many scientific fields. These instruments are crucial for pushing scientific knowledge forward, making important discoveries, and spurring innovation in various industries. The market includes items like microscopes, spectroscopy devices, chromatography systems, laboratory balances, and more. These tools are used in fields such as life sciences, chemistry, physics, materials science, environmental science, and geology, among others. The market's growth comes from increased research and development, technological improvements, and the need for precise measurements. Innovations like automation, artificial intelligence, and making instruments smaller are changing what these tools can do, making data collection, analysis, and understanding complex scientific questions easier. The market is also affected by the growth of pharmaceutical and biotechnology industries, which need advanced instruments for things like drug discovery and studying genes and proteins. Plus, concerns about the environment and rules about it are driving the need for instruments that can monitor pollution, analyze water, and control quality. In terms of where the market grows, established research centers and schools are important, but countries that are starting to do more scientific research are also playing a big role. Also, when academics, businesses, and governments work together, it helps the market grow even more.

Global Scientific Instruments Market Segmental Analysis
The global Scientific Instruments market is segmented on the basis of Type, Application, End user and region. By Type, the market is segmented into Clinical Analyzers, Analytical Instruments, Others. By Application, the market is segmented into Research, Clinical & Diagnostics, Others. By End user, the market is segmented into Hospitals & Diagnostic Laboratories, Pharmaceutical & Biotechnology Companies, Others. By region, the market is segmented into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, Middle East and Africa, and Latin America.
Drivers of the Global Scientific Instruments Market
The scientific instruments market is moving forward because of constant new technologies. Progress in areas like biotechnology, nanotechnology, and materials science means there's more need for instruments that are very precise, sensitive, and can work on their own. Researchers and businesses use these instruments to do difficult experiments and analyses, which helps the market grow.
Restraints in the Global Scientific Instruments Market
Scientific instruments can be expensive because they use advanced technology and are made for specific tasks. The high initial costs can make it hard for smaller research groups and new businesses to buy these instruments, which can slow down how much the market grows.
Market Trends of the Global Scientific Instruments Market
The scientific instruments market is seeing a shift towards making instruments more precise and smaller. Improvements in nanotechnology and techniques for making things on a tiny scale have made it possible to make smaller, more precise scientific instruments. These compact tools are more sensitive, accurate, and easier to carry around, so they can be used in many different ways, like for medical tests or checking the environment. This change is because people want tests that can be done right away, need tools for research outside of labs, and want to use less of the things they test. Because of this, companies are working on making new, small instruments that work well.
